1. Clinical Tumor Biology & Immunotherapy Group, Ludwig Centre for Cancer Research, Department of Oncology, University Hospital of Lausanne Lausanne Switzerland
2. These authors contributed equally to this work
3. Institute of Infection, Immunity and Inflammation, University of Glasgow Glasgow United Kingdom